Workington and Harrington Pits
JACKSON, Herbert & Mary
Hirst-Jackson, Maryport, 1989, Numbered Limited Edition,(072), softback with stiff card wraps, VG, illustrated throughout from b/w photographs, including one on the inside of front cover and one on the title page, and one hand drawn map, 48 pp.
No inscription or annotations, sound tight binding, pages clean and bright. Wraps clean and crisp, either side of spine sunned, gentle rubs to head and tail.
